Jane Stephens
CHS Teacher, Counselor, CISD Administrator
1976-2000
Jane Stephens began her association with Canyon High School in 1961 when she began her student observation classes as an education major at West Texas State College. This was the first year Canyon High spent on the previous campus. She did her student teaching 1963 with Mrs. Lillian Graham she fondly remembers her student teaching as an amazing opportunity to sit at the feet of a Master Teacher.
Teaching experience at Canyon High School includes two years in the late 1960 s and eight years from 1976 to 1984. She taught Social Studies classes, mostly Economics, and French. During those years she cosponsored Future Teachers of America she also spent several years as the cheerleader sponsor. She served as Social Studies Department Chairman and as President of the Randall County Unit of Texas States Teachers Association. She also attended West Texas State University and received a Master"s degree and certification in Counseling.
In 1984 she took the position of counselor at Canyon High School. She served in that position for three years, helping to move CHS from hand generated scheduling to computer generated scheduling. In 1987, she became Director of Secondary Curriculum for Canyon ISD. During that period puttered related fields. She served in that position until 1992 when she was named Assistant Superintendent of Curriculum and Instruction. From 1992 to 1999, Mrs. Stephens assisted in building strong curricular programs and adding Westover Park Intermediate School and Crestview Elementary School to the district. She is especially proud of the advancements CISD made in Technology and in Campus Improvement Planning.
Jane retired in June, 2000. She is currently active in the First Presbyterian Church, serving as ruling Elder. She also works for the Education Department of WTAMU supervising administrative interns and for the Panhandle Plains Historical Museum as a curriculum consultant. She is a founding member of the Education Foundations of CISD, a member of the board of the Canyon Boys and Girls Club and of the Opportunity School.
Her family includes: Her husband, Dr. J. Pat Stephens, her daughter and son-in-law, Jennifer and Robert Stubbs and their two children Xander and Mayabella and son and daughter-in-law, Dr. Robert and Heather Gumbert Stephens.
